What Is Full Body Red Light Therapy?
Full body red light therapy is commonly described as photobiomodulation therapy, or PBM therapy. It uses visible red and near-infrared light to illuminate the body without UV. The experience is non-invasive and designed to be comfortable. While research is developing and outcomes vary from person to person, many people explore PBM therapy as part of their wellness routines, with interests that may include:
- Supporting a relaxed state and general well-being
- Complementing workout recovery and active lifestyles
- Exploring skin appearance goals such as tone and texture support
- Adding a technology-based option to a broader self-care plan
Important note: red light therapy does not tan the skin, does not involve UV exposure, and should not be viewed as medical treatment. Anyone with health concerns, photosensitivity, medications that increase light sensitivity, pregnancy, or skin conditions should speak with a qualified healthcare professional before exploring light-based wellness services.

What to Expect During a TheraLight 360+ Session at CW TAN & WELLNESS
Most new clients want to know exactly what the session feels like and how to prepare. Here is a simple overview:
- Before you arrive: Come hydrated. Remove heavy makeup, thick lotions, or sunscreen from the areas you plan to expose. Bring comfortable clothing that is easy to change out of and back into.
- During the session: You will lie comfortably while the TheraLight 360+ system surrounds your body with red and near-infrared light. The light is bright and the warmth is typically gentle. Protective eyewear is available and recommended. Most people simply relax and breathe.
- After the session: There is no downtime, so you can resume normal activities right away. Many clients plan red light therapy as part of a routine on the way to or from work, errands, or the gym.

Red Light Therapy vs Tanning and Home Panels
Red Light Therapy vs Tanning
Red light therapy is not tanning. It does not use UV light, it will not darken your skin, and it should not be confused with sun tanning beds. If you have photosensitivity, a history of skin issues, or use medications that increase light sensitivity, talk with a qualified healthcare professional before using any light-based service.
Full Body Red Light Therapy Bed vs Small Home Devices
Some people compare professional full body systems to at-home panels. While home devices can be convenient, they often cover smaller areas at a time, which can make consistent, full body sessions more time-consuming. By contrast, a 360 degree red light therapy bed provides whole body exposure in one session. A professional setting also means a private, clean space and staff who can guide you on comfort, eyewear, and general best practices.
